こんにちは。文字列として、ダブルコーテーションを表示させるには、どうすればよいのか教えてください。m(__)m


例えば、
<font size="2">あいうえお</font>

というタグの「あいうえお」の部分が、セルA1にあった場合、

="<font size="2">"&A1&"</font>"という表示にしたいのです。

"2"のダブルコーテーションも文字列として表示させるには、どうすればよろしいのでしょうか。

教えてください。よろしくお願い致します。

A 回答 (5件)

#2の方のやり方でいいと思いますが、言葉で言うと、


>ダブルコーテーションを、ダブルコーテーションで囲んでください。
じゃなくて、
" " の中で文字として " を書きたいときは2個連続して "" と書くと1個の " に置き換わります。

セルに =""" と入れるとエラーです。="""" と入れると1つの"を表示します。

これはセル中の式だけじゃなく、マクロ(VBA)で文字列を使うときでも同じです。
    • good
    • 0
この回答へのお礼

まとめてのお礼で、申し訳ございません。
大変たすかりました。おかげで間に合いました!!(>x<

一時は全てコピペをしなくてはいけないのかと、ゾッっとしておりました。

ありがとうございました、勉強になりました!!

お礼日時:2005/08/29 09:54

エクセルの質問らしいが、最後の手段は


=CHAR(34) &"1"&CHAR(34)
CHAR(34)が半角のダブルコーテーションです。
    • good
    • 7

Excelでよろしいのでしょうか?



=CHAR(34) とすることで ダブルコーテーション(")を返します

これを使い
="<font size=" & CHAR(34) & "2" & CHAR(34) & ">" & A1 & "</font>"

とするとそのセルの表示が <font size="2">あいうえお</font> となります

CHAR関数の引数は ASCIIコード一覧に載っています(Excelのヘルプにもあります)

お望みのものと違ったらごめんなさい・・・
    • good
    • 2

こんにちは~



表示形式は 「標準」 のままで、
ダブルコーテーションを、ダブルコーテーションで囲んでください。

""2""

="<font size=""2"">"&A1&"</font>"

としてみてください。
    • good
    • 4

こんばんは。


面白い設問なのでやってみました。

最初にそのセルを選択し、書式→セル→表示形式と進んで窓の中にある「文字列」を選びます。
そのうえでそのセルに書き込むとダブルクォーテーションも文字として認識します。
    • good
    • 0

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!

このQ&Aを見た人はこんなQ&Aも見ています

今、見られている記事はコレ!

おしトピ編集部からのゆる~い質問を出題中

お題をもっとみる

このQ&Aを見た人が検索しているワード


このQ&Aを見た人がよく見るQ&A

このカテゴリの人気Q&Aランキング

おすすめ情報

カテゴリ